Ubuntu 8.04 serveur d'utiliser VI pour éditer des fichiers

  • devilwood
  • Silver Member
  • Silver Member
  • Avatar de l’utilisateur
  • Inscription: Nov 18, 2007
  • Messages: 429
  • Status: Offline

Message Mai 11th, 2009, 2:00 pm

Im encore s'habituer à la ligne de commande du nu ubuntu serveur édition. Ive actuellement installé vsftpd et Im avoir quelques problèmes avec elle.

1. Editing. Conf ou des fichiers texte avec VI est juste horrible. Son complètement instable et ne fait pas ce que je veux qu'elle. Donc, premièrement, il est une autre option pour le montage .conf / fichiers texte avec juste la ligne de commande version serveur de ubuntu?

2. Où puis-je trouver les commandes VI éditeur de texte? J'ai enfin trouvé shift + z va enregistrer un fichier. J'ai besoin d'une liste de la plupart d'entre eux.

3. J'ai été le montage de mon dossier et vsftpd.conf Im maintenant sa me dit j'ai besoin de récupérer et / ou supprimer le fichier d'échange. Aussi, le vsftpd.conf est maintenant en place pour en lecture seule je ne peux donc pas terminer mes changements. J'ai juste besoin d'aucune explication quant à ce qui se passe ici. Je ne reçois un message au (ajouter! À override) Im mais ne savez pas comment l'utiliser.

4. Mon premier problème est que lors du transfert de fichiers à mon var / www / répertoire des fichiers deviennent pas les permissions. Ils faisaient de 600 et 700 ci-joint et j'ai vraiment besoin de 644 automatiquement transférés sur quoi que ce soit à mon répertoire Web. SO,

J'ai ajouté à mon vsftpd.conf fichier:
file_open_mode = 666
local_umask = 022

vsftpd redémarré, et il ne fonctionne toujours pas. SO, je vais essayer a 4 chiffres pour la valeur de ces options, quand j'ai commencé à avoir le problème en #3.

Merci pour toute aide.
  • Anonymous
  • Bot
  • No Avatar
  • Inscription: 25 Feb 2008
  • Messages: ?
  • Loc: Ozzuland
  • Status: Online

Message Mai 11th, 2009, 2:00 pm

  • kc0tma
  • o|||||||o
  • Web Master
  • Avatar de l’utilisateur
  • Inscription: Juil 20, 2007
  • Messages: 3318
  • Loc: Trout Creek, MT
  • Status: Offline

Message Mai 11th, 2009, 2:26 pm

Vi-t-il vraiment pas ce que vous le souhaitez, ou vous êtes tout simplement pas le droit de dire à vi de choses à faire? Rappelez-vous: Garbage in, garbage out.

Certains de vos commandes vi plus communes sont: wq pour sauvegarder,: q! sans tout à fait à l'épargne,: w pour sauver et non pas simplement de cesser de fumer, \ searchterm à la recherche de quelque chose..... Faites une recherche google pour des commandes vi.

Pour votre fichier d'échange chose, si vous allez dans le répertoire de votre vsftp. fichier de conf et faire un ls-a, vous devriez voir un fichier se terminant par. swp <- qui est le fichier d'échange. J'ai eu un fichier de configuration squid aller funky sur moi la semaine dernière et qu'il a effectué ce swp fichier et la façon dont je liquidation de fixation, il a été fait par cp squid.conf.swp squid.conf et puis il a dit oui à écraser l'original squid.conf, vous pouvez essayer la même chose, mais l'échange avec vsftp.conf squid.conf. Cela pourrait ne pas être la meilleure façon de le résoudre, ou Don Anarchy me corrigera si il ya une meilleure façon de faire.
Like Mr Spork, I also write about my interest in alcoholic beverages.
  • devilwood
  • Silver Member
  • Silver Member
  • Avatar de l’utilisateur
  • Inscription: Nov 18, 2007
  • Messages: 429
  • Status: Offline

Message Mai 11th, 2009, 2:40 pm

Dès que j'ai posté, j'ai essayé des commandes vi dans google et a obtenu une liste. Google ne m'a pas fait ça avant.

VI Avec les touches ne fonctionnaient pas. Je voudrais passer de remplacement et insérer en utilisant la clé d'insérer d'autres touches, mais aucune ne serait pas à faire des changements ou des sauts de ligne. Puis j'ai eu une tonne de signes montrant @ unlimitied et les valeurs de local_umask. Ainsi, il semblait que ce VI:

@
@
@ Etc etc pour un peu de moyens alors à
local_umask = 022022022022022022022022 toujours etc etc


Je yanked le fichier ftp de la regarder et il semblait bien. J'ai ensuite utilisé nano pour l'éditer et je n'ai pas de problèmes d'édition des données. Aussi, le fichier semble bon sous nano.

Dernière chose.
Je suis toujours de ne pas avoir les permissions quand je transférer des fichiers vers mon www / dossier. Modification de la local_umask et en ajoutant file_open_mode = 666 ne fonctionne pas. Toutes les idées sur ce que je peux essayer? Toutes mes recherches pour les permissions à-dire automatiquement être mis sur les transferts de fichier à utiliser local_umask. Im pas connecté anonymement, mais Im connecter en tant que créé mon utilisateur. La création d'utilisateur est également ajoutée à un groupe créé www-data.

Mauvais contrôle de votre commande avec le fichier d'échange si cela se produit de nouveau, mais seulement Id déjà restauré le fichier à l'aide

vim-r / etc / vsftpd.conf

donc plus de problèmes là-bas.

merci encore pour l'aide.

Afficher de l'information

  • Total des messages de ce sujet: 3 messages
  •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 60 invités
  • Vous ne pouvez pas poster de nouveaux sujets
  • Vous ne pouvez pas répondre aux sujets
  • Vous ne pouvez pas éditer vos messages
  • Vous ne pouvez pas supprimer vos messages
  • Vous ne pouvez pas joindre des fichiers
 
 

© 2011 Unmelted, LLC. Ozzu® est une marque déposée de Unmelted, LLC